Output 6c3436079d72f61e51210b8150d9a5a34a25702d36bcaeb2d33ae5566a9194b4:4

value
33993428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b4073224dcb754331d8c9aff67c9cc9dfaa9ee9 OP_EQUAL
address
MWof3dGqt7z4dzHCstSfsnB9vvS8G8Uoa7
transaction
6c3436079d72f61e51210b8150d9a5a34a25702d36bcaeb2d33ae5566a9194b4
spent
true